I know that when I summarize the work of Christ I speak of the life, death, and resurrection of Christ. I guess that I have indoctrinated myself into think that those three things are the most essential things for the gospel of Christ to be true. So, I wonder why I and many other Christians do not say, “life, death, resurrection, and ascension of Christ.” Why is it so easy for Christians to leave out the blessing of the ascension of Christ? Do we see the ascension of Christ as a blessing? If you are curious about these questions please stay tuned to our sermon titled, “Ascending Beyond Canaan.”
